Under new flag, Lafayette makes new request to transship in South Pacific



 

The reflagging has now been achieved. According to a letter  circulated by the secretariat of the SPRFMO  and seen byUndercurrent,  the vessel &mdash which is able to transship and process, but  not equipped to fish  &ndash changed flag  to Peru on July 16.

Along with the new flag came a new name &mdash the vessel is now called Damanzaihao, shows the letter, dated Aug. 13  and sent by Peru' s production ministry Produce to Johanne Fischer, the SPRFMO' s new executive secretary.

The letter informs the SPRFMO that Damanzaiho has applied to take part in the fishery.

Aug. 29, 11.02am: Anchovy, from fishmeal to ' deluxe' product

Peru&rsquo s anchovy fishery is so huge that it can supply the largest fishmeal industry in the world and, stil, there is enough resource for the human consumption division.

Some Peruvian producers, such as Pesquera Diamante, are already supplying domestic market with canned anchovy in different sauces, and others, like Tri Marine' s Conservera de las Americas, are pinning their hopes on exports of canned anchovy.

But there is still room to explore anchovy' s potential.

The country' s Ministry of Production, Produce, has developed a new gourmet product: " deluxe" canned anchovy.

Wrapped in slick packaging and marinated in oriental sauces, the cans are expected to become a popular product among Peruvians, simply because they taste " delicious" , Melva Pazos, coordinator at Produce' s researching division for human consumption products, told Undercurrent News.

Premium canned anchovy has been presented to seafood processors at Expoalimentaria and there are already several companies that have shown interest in the product, Pazos said.

Fitch: Extension of Consent Solicitation Won' t Impact China Fishery Ratings

Mon Aug 25, 2014 9:31am GMT


(The following statement was released by the rating agency) HONG KONG/SINGAPORE, August 25 (Fitch) Fitch Ratings says today that giving bondholders of Corporacion Pesquera Inca SAC (COPEINCA, B+/Stable) one more month to decide if they consent to changes in the bond indenture will not impact Fitch' s ratings on its parent China Fishery Group Limited (China Fishery BB-/Negative). The Chinese company' s fundamentals remain strong and as a result, the risk of it facing immediate liquidity issues from this event remains low. The purpose of the consent solicitation is to remove the restriction on Copeinca ASA, COPEINCA' s parent, and the operating entities under it from guaranteeing debts of China Fishery Group. China Fishery acquired Copeinca ASA, a major anchovy-quota holder in Peru, in 2013. The extension of the consent solicitation to 17 September 2014 reflects the reluctance of COPEINCA bondholders to agree to the amended indenture at the current consent fee of 1%. In general, the process to win consent from bondholders can be lengthy and often requires several iterations of the offer. In the event bondholders refuse to give consent regardless of terms, China Fishery would have to refinance the COPEINCA bonds immediately. The risk of both the consent solicitation failing and COPEINCA' s creditors refusing to give China Fishery any grace period to seek refinancing for the bonds is low. China Fishery' s operation remains cash generative and it is likely to generate positive free cash flow to help in its deleveraging. Revenue for the nine months to 30 June 2014 increased by 13.4% from a year earlier and EBITDA margin increased to 44.5% from 43.2%, primarily due to higher revenue contribution and cost savings from the enlarged Peruvian fishmeal operations, which offset the thinner trading margins from the spot purchase business in Russia. Fitch expects the underlying earnings profile of China Fishery to strengthen given the firm demand for fishmeal, a staple needed for aquaculture globally, and savings to be realised from the further consolidation of its enlarged Peruvian business. The refund of a total US$241.5m from a long-term supply agreement (LSA) with its Russian suppliers is on track. China Fishery received US$80m in June 2014 and it expects to receive another US$60m by the end of the current fiscal year on 30 September 2014 (FY14) with the remaining to be fully paid by end of FY16. Its inventory of USD183m at end-June 2014 will be partly liquidated by the end of FY14 as the fishing season enters its lowest point. This cash release together with the LSA refund might drive China Fishery' s FY14 net leverage to below 3.5x if management continues to deleverage. China Fishery' s ability to generate positive free cash flow of about USD90m from FY15 will help the company reduce its leverage to below 3.0x by FY16.
